Eavestrough Clearing in Long Island, NY
Eavestrough clearing services involve the removal of leaves, debris, and obstructions from the gutters that run along the edges of a property’s roof. This process helps ensure that rainwater flows properly through the gutters and downspouts, preventing water from pooling or overflowing onto the roof, siding, or foundation. Projects typically include cleaning residential properties, commercial buildings, and multi-unit complexes, especially in areas prone to heavy leaf fall or storm debris. Homeowners often request this service to protect their property from water damage, mold growth, and structural issues caused by clogged gutters.
Before requesting eavestrough clearing, property owners should consider the condition and accessibility of their gutters, as well as any specific concerns about water drainage or pest infestations. It is helpful to identify whether the gutters are damaged or require repairs alongside cleaning, and to determine if additional services such as gutter guards or downspout extensions might be beneficial. Understanding the scope of the project and any particular challenges, such as difficult access or overgrown landscaping, can assist in planning an effective and thorough cleaning process.

Eavestrough Clearing Questions
What is eavestrough clearing? Eavestrough clearing involves removing leaves, debris, and buildup from gutters to ensure proper water flow away from the property.
Why is regular eavestrough cleaning important? Regular cleaning helps prevent water damage, foundation issues, and pest problems caused by clogged gutters.
How often should eavestroughs be cleaned? It is recommended to clean gutters at least twice a year, especially during fall and spring seasons.
What signs indicate eavestroughs need cleaning? Signs include overflowing gutters, water pooling near the foundation, and visible debris or sagging gutters.
